  Where were the five world religions located around 1500 a.d. (c.e.)?
  
  
  &amp;nbsp;
  Location of world religions in 1500 a.d. (c.e.)
  ·&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; *Judaism: Concentrated in Europe and the Middle
  East
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Christianity: Concentrated in Europe and the
  Middle East
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Islam: Parts of Asia, Africa, and southern
  Europe
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Hinduism: India and part of Southeast Asia
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Buddhism: East and Southeast Asia

  What are some characteristics of the five major world
  religions?
  
  
  &amp;nbsp;
  Judaism
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Monotheism
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Ten Commandments of moral and religious
  conduct
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Torah: Written records and beliefs of the Jews
  &amp;nbsp;
  Christianity
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Monotheism
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Jesus as Son of God
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Life after death
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  New Testament: Life and teachings of Jesus
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Establishment of Christian doctrines by early
  church councils
  &amp;nbsp;
  Islam
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Monotheism
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Muhammad, the prophet
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Qur’an (Koran)
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Five Pillars of Islam
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Mecca and Medina
  &amp;nbsp;
  Buddhism
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Founder: Siddhartha Gautama (Buddha)
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Four Noble Truths
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Eightfold Path to Enlightenment
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Spread of Buddhism from India to China and
  other parts of Asia, resulting from Asoka’s missionaries and their writings
  &amp;nbsp;
  Hinduism
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Many forms of one God
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Reincarnation: Rebirth based upon karma
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Karma: Knowledge that all thoughts and actions
  result in future consequences

  Where are the followers of the five world religions
  concentrated?
  
  
  &amp;nbsp;
  Geographic distribution of world’s major religions
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Judaism: Concentrated in Israel and North America
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Christianity: Concentrated in Europe and North
  and South America
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Islam: Concentrated in the Middle East,
  Africa, and Asia
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Hinduism: Concentrated in India
  ·&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;
  Buddhism: Concentrated in East and Southeast
  Asia
